NBA Mega Star Kevin Durant has reduced access to its Coinbase account, the Crypto Exchange Giant confirmed to Decrypt Via e -mail on Thursday.
During a broader discussion about the business interests of Durant on Tuesday CNBCs Game planning in Los Angeles, the player of the player, Rich Kleiman, made light of his customer’s inability to log in to the account that he opened almost 10 years ago.
Since 2021, the 36-year-old Durant, who will play for the Houston Rockets this season, has held a deal Coinbase To promote the brand.
Since 2017, he and Kleiman have also been investors in the company up to and including 35V, the investment fund they have founded.
In a statement that was forwarded to decode from Coinbase, Kleiman said that he and Durant “had worked directly with the Coinbase team on Kevin’s account Recovery, that was why it was easy for him” to make a joke about it on stage. “
“It was a user error on our side and the process is clearly out of the leap,” he said. “Our partnership includes almost ten years and Coinbase has been a valuable source when growing our company.”
Durant bought his first Bitcoin at the end of 2016, shortly after a birthday party organized by Ben Horowitz, co-founder of the risk capital company Andreessen Horowitz, where visitors to Bitcoin made a central subject.
Durant had just become a member of the Golden State Warriors, where he would win an NBA championship the next spring. “The entire Warriors team came, and at the end of that night I had something like:” Kevin, I heard the word Bitcoin 25 times tonight “and the next day we started investing in Bitcoin,” Kleiman said the audience of the game plan.
But to laugh, Kleiman told the audience that Durant had not been able to “track down his Coinbase account information.”
“It’s just, it’s insane. It is real:” Oh, you, you really don’t have the password? ” We really don’t have it, “Kleiman said, although he will get it.
Bitcoin traded at around $ 600 when Durant made his first acquisitions. The larg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ization was recently traded at around $ 117,100, according to Crypto data provider Coingecko. Bitcoin has risen more than 950% in the last five years.
Durant, the seventh most important scorer in the NBA history, is one of an increasing series of high-profile professional athletes who have become Bitcoin investors and advocates investments in digital assets.
